How New Balance is stepping into sneaker resale with Reconsidered launch

Inside Retail

Items include consumer returns and cosmetically imperfect footwear that cannot be sold as new but have been cleaned as needed. The technology to facilitate New Balance’s Reconsidered experience and the fulfillment of these products is provided by ​​Archive, a technology platform for branded resale.

Pacsun Improves Profitability with Intelligent Allocation and Replenishment with Antuit.ai

Retail Focus

Californian lifestyle fashion brand, Pacsun , doubled its ship completes by better anticipating online demand and intelligently leveraging its stores as ecommerce fulfilment centres, partnering with antuit.ai , a leader in AI-powered SaaS solutions for consumer products and retail insights and now part of Zebra Technologies.

City Chic’s sales slip; promotions dent margins

Inside Retail

Global plus-size fashion retailer City Chic is gearing up for a loss in its December half earnings as “volatile” demand has led to poor sales. In a trading update based on unaudited accounts for the period to January 1, the business recorded a sales decline of 8 per cent to $168.6 Online sales fell 21 per cent.
